County by county

The Lexington Park, MD metro spans 2 counties, and rent and home prices vary a lot between them. These are whole-stock medians for people already living there, so rents run below the asking rents used elsewhere on this page.

Population, rent, home value, income and commute by county in Lexington Park, MD
CountyPeopleMedian rent2-bed rentHome valueIncomeCommute
St. Mary's CountyMD114k55%$1,692$1,604$390,900$114,58030 min
Calvert CountyMD94k45%$1,701$1,441$440,200$132,05941 min

Census ACS 2023 5-year estimates by county; county membership from the 2023 CBSA delineation file. Rents are median gross rent for occupied units (not asking rent); “—” means the Census suppressed or top-coded the cell.
